Paige Bueckers just turned 24, and the WNBA made sure she felt the love. The Dallas Wings’ star and 2025 No. 1 overall pick marked the moment by posting a set of photos on Instagram that pretty much summed up her journey so far — from family and UConn memories to her big leap into the pros.

“God didn’t play at all about year 23. Forever Blessed and highly favored. Thank you God!” Bueckers wrote in her caption, capping off a post that had fans and fellow players flooding her comments section.

Steph Curry’s sister, Sydel Curry-Lee, jumped in first with a quick shoutout.
“Libra gang! Birthday twin,” she wrote.
Then came Chicago’s Angel Reese, who’s become tight with Paige since their All-Star weekend run. Her message? Classic Angel.
“happy birthday pskiiiii,” she commented.
Even Sparks forward Dearica Hamby joined in, throwing in her signature humor.
“Damn. You almost was a Scorpio 🔥🔥 happy birthday lol.”
All the birthday love came after what’s been a breakout rookie year for Bueckers. The Wings guard averaged 19.2 points, 5.4 assists, and 3.9 boards across 36 games — and of course, snagged Rookie of the Year honors. It’s the kind of debut people had already predicted back on draft night, but she made it official in style.
“He loves Paige”: Paige Bueckers’ former UConn teammate shares wholesome story
While birthday wishes poured in, Paige Bueckers also got a surprise mention from an old teammate. Golden State Valkyries guard Kaitlyn Chen shared a lighthearted story from when her team faced Dallas earlier this season.

Chen revealed on Azzi Fudd’s “Fudd Around and Find Out” podcast that her dad showed up to the game wearing Bueckers’ UConn jersey.
“He loves Paige, and he was like, ‘This is my one chance to wear my Paige jersey,'” Chen said. “Don’t worry, he talked to me about it before, and I honestly thought it would be pretty funny. So I was like, ‘Go for it.'”
Chen and Bueckers famously helped UConn capture a national title before entering the 2025 WNBA Draft. And while Chen’s dad remains her biggest supporter, he’s never hidden the fact that he’s just as big a Bueckers fan.
